Transaction 440997e354fa831951426a4267236f482910fa20d77400c2617543d2a9306046
1 Input
1 Output
-
440997e354fa831951426a4267236f482910fa20d77400c2617543d2a9306046:0
- value
- 74939
- script pubkey
- OP_0 OP_PUSHBYTES_20 34f6dd14587d890e0b3f964a0e080e3ce0de75a8
- address
- bc1qxnmd69zc0kysuzelje9quzqw8nsduadgkrmk8n